In Occupied Kashmir, complete shutdown is being observed on Friday, to protest against the ongoing killing spree by Indian troops in the territory.
Call for the shutdown has been given by the Joint Resistance Leadership.
All shops and business establishments are closed in Srinagar and all other major cities and towns of the occupied territory while traffic is off the road.
Meanwhile, the occupation authorities continue to suspend class work in almost all educational institutions including colleges and Higher Secondary Schools in the valley for the third consecutive day, today.
